When would you send this lady to the ER? What factors will you take into consideration here?
Hospitalization ought to be considered for all patients whose side effects don’t improve or transmit with beginning forceful treatment of the intense worsening. So for Michelle if there is a decrease in oxygen saturation an increase in shortness of breath, she is unable to speak, and wheezing or diminished breath sounds I would call for transport to the hospital (Buttaro, 2017). Peak flow meters can also determine the severity of the disease; by using the guidelines that are provided by the NHLBIA 2012 diagnosis can be met. An incomplete response of FEV1 or PEF of 40%-69% is categorized, as moderate to severe symptoms and this person should be admitted to the hospital. And if the response is poor with a FEV1 or PEF below 40% this person should be admitted to the intensive care unit (GINA, 2015).
